BT helps secure healthcare industry

Telco giant partners with Siemens Medical Services to aid compliance with healthcare security rules

BT has strengthened its identity and access management (IAM) portfolio through a partnership with Siemens Medical Services.

The deal will see the telco push Siemens Meds DirX IAM product suite at UK healthcare institutions as a means of complying with industry regulations on data security.

DirX automates user accounts, grants associated access rights and offers integration with SAP systems such as NetWeaver. It can also utilise smartcards and other kinds of physical access technologies, which should help IT departments ensure that only authorised medical staff can access sensitive patient data.

In a report commissioned by BT last year, Forrester Research concluded that IAM has a number of benefits beyond security and compliance, including increased employee productivity and mobility, reduced help desk costs and centralised IT management.

The alliance between BT and Siemens Meds will initially focus on providing IAM solutions to the UK, France, Germany and the US. It is not clear if BT will use DirX for other UK customers outside the healthcare industry.
